    The Refrigeration Technician provides industrial maintenance support to ensure the safe and effective operation of the production facility. Key responsibilities include the maintenance, repair, and safe operation of the production facility's mechanical infrastructure, including ammonia-based refrigeration systems, HVAC systems and boilers. Additional responsibilities include the repair, troubleshooting and maintenance of the facility manufacturing systems.
